    All characters will get all achievement so order does not matter from that perspective. Achievements do indicate which character earned the achievement and when it was earned. If you want your main to listed as the earner for most of the achievements, then log in to your main first and then the others.

    You may need to micro manage some achievement like true style master - which adds up the number of styles learned on each character. If you want your main listed as the earner for this achievement, you need to keep track of the counter and make sure you main learns the 50th motif so another character's name is not listed.
